Online CNC machining services offer a streamlined, digitalfirst approach to manufacturing critical automotive components. From engine brackets and sensor housings to complex transmission parts and custom interior elements, CNC technology provides the unparalleled accuracy and repeatability essential for automotive applications. The use of advanced materials like aluminum alloys, stainless steels, and engineering plastics (such as PEEK or nylon) is standard, ensuring parts meet rigorous standards for strength, thermal resistance, and durability.

The true growth accelerator lies in the online model. It democratizes access to highend manufacturing. Automotive startups, R&D teams, and established OEMs can now upload their CAD designs, instantly receive DFM (Design for Manufacturing) feedback, choose from a vast material library, and get transparent, automated pricing. This process compresses lead times from weeks to days, enabling rapid iteration for prototyping and facilitating ondemand production runs that reduce inventory costs.
